Google Drive Storage Capacity
In Google Workspace for Education, there was no per-user storage limit for Google Drive and Gmail. However, storage limitations were introduced starting March 15, 2023.
From February 2025 onward, the maximum storage limit for students and staff is set to 100GB.
The maximum storage limit per account based on user affiliation.
制限値 | |
---|---|
Faculty | No limit ※ |
Students (including Correspondence Course Students) | 20GB to 100GB |
Staff | 5GB to 100GB |

At this time, no restrictions will be applied to faculty storage. However, limitations may be implemented in the future. We kindly ask for your cooperation in organizing unnecessary data and migrating it to other storage options if needed.
